To that end, a grail should be borderline unachievable. If it’s just expensive that’s not a grail. They must be rare, if not completely unique. IMO, the grail is about the quest as much as it is the goal.
Your grail watch should require you to have to do research and learn about the watch to get the right one. Even if you fail in your quest and never own your grail, you’ll be richer in knowledge.
